Amazon Kindle Ebook Reader, $139 to $379

Despite all the competition, the Kindle remains a popular ebook reader choice. It has a crisp display, great battery life, and a zippy interface.

There are Wi-Fi-only, Wi-Fi+3G, and extra large DX versions of the device available.

Webster’s Third New International Dictionary of the English Language

If big is better, the unabridged Webster's Third New International Dictionary is among the best. Weighing 12.5 pounds and measuring 4 inches thick, its 2,662 pages define more than 450,000 words spanning "a" to "zyzzogeton," including words ("disselboom" for instance) not found in other dictionaries, plus clear definitions, comprehensive etymologies, interesting asides, literary usage quotes, and a comfortable typeface.
